  1. Gehm, Michael E. and McCain, Scott T. and Pitsianis, Nikos P. and Brady, David J. and Potuluri, Prasant and Sullivan, Michael E., Static two-dimensional aperture coding for multimodal, multiplex spectroscopy, Applied Optics, vol. 45 no. 13 (2006), pp. 2965 - 2974 [AO.45.002965]
    (last updated on 2007/04/11)

    Abstract:
    We propose a new class of aperture-coded spectrometer that is optimized for the spectral characterization of diffuse sources. The instrument achieves high throughput and high spectral resolution by replacing the slit of conventional dispersive spectrometers with a more complicated spatial filter. We develop a general mathematical framework for deriving the required aperture codes and discuss several appealing code families. Experimental results validate the performance of the instrument. © 2006 Optical Society of America.
